Shri Jagannath Temple
This religious complex on Puri beach has lofty spire, shimmering with the fixed flag which can be witnessed as far as 7 kms away. Dedicated to Lord Jagannath, the temple culture indicates its strong Hindu religious faith. Its main gate of the temple follows the 35-foot high pillar- the Arunastambh, while its fine architecture depicts the power of its builder-Yayati Keshari, who set up the temple sometime in 10th century CE. Unlike the peak visiting season, the temple calls for closest attention during the Rath Festival, held every year in the month of July.

Eating at Puri
Puri is known for its culinary delights. The beach is full of way-side food-stalls and also a number of restaurants like the Grand Complex, Annapurna Restaurant, BNR Hotel, Puri Hotel and Wild Grass are set up at the back lanes. All the food-courts serves both the vegetarian and non-vegetarian cuisines like fish and crab pakoda, paneer fry, Kheera(local delicacy) etc. Visitors who desires to relish the Chinese dishes can move on to Chung Wah, situated on VIP Road.

How to reach Puri Beach
By Air
Biju Patnaik Airport, situated 56 kms away from the beach, in Bhubaneswar is the nearest railhead. Serviced flight operating to and from the major international airport, aids visitors reach the place.

By Rail
Puri Railway Station on the East Coast Railway operates express train and connects the place with major Indian cities like New Delhi, Kolkata, Ahmedabad, Jodhpur, Haridwar and Guwahati.
